LLDB mainline
lldb_private::plugin::dwarf::DWARFASTParser Member List

This is the complete list of members for lldb_private::plugin::dwarf::DWARFASTParser, including all inherited members.

CompleteTypeFromDWARF(const DWARFDIE &die, Type *type, const CompilerType &compiler_type)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
ConstructDemangledNameFromDWARF(const DWARFDIE &die)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
DWARFASTParser(Kind kind)lldb_private::plugin::dwarf::DWARFASTParserinline
EnsureAllDIEsInDeclContextHaveBeenParsed(CompilerDeclContext decl_context)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
GetAccessTypeFromDWARF(uint32_t dwarf_accessibility)lldb_private::plugin::dwarf::DWARFASTParserstatic
GetDeclContextContainingUIDFromDWARF(const DWARFDIE &die)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
GetDeclContextForUIDFromDWARF(const DWARFDIE &die)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
GetDeclForUIDFromDWARF(const DWARFDIE &die)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
GetDIEClassTemplateParams(const DWARFDIE &die)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
GetKind() constlldb_private::plugin::dwarf::DWARFASTParserinline
GetTypeForDIE(const DWARFDIE &die)lldb_private::plugin::dwarf::DWARFASTParser
Kind enum namelldb_private::plugin::dwarf::DWARFASTParser
m_kindlldb_private::plugin::dwarf::DWARFASTParserprivate
ParseChildArrayInfo(const DWARFDIE &parent_die, const ExecutionContext *exe_ctx=nullptr)lldb_private::plugin::dwarf::DWARFASTParserstatic
ParseFunctionFromDWARF(CompileUnit &comp_unit, const DWARFDIE &die, const AddressRange &range)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
ParseTypeFromDWARF(const SymbolContext &sc, const DWARFDIE &die, bool *type_is_new_ptr)=0lldb_private::plugin::dwarf::DWARFASTParserpure virtual
~DWARFASTParser()=defaultlldb_private::plugin::dwarf::DWARFASTParservirtual